Type Issue Detection
Analyze PHP code for type safety issues.
Detection Patterns
1. Implicit Type Coercion
php
// BUG: String to int coercion
$count = '10abc'; // PHP converts to 10
$total = $count + 5; // 15, not error
// BUG: Array comparison
$a = [1, 2, 3];
$b = '1,2,3';
if ($a == $b) { } // Unexpected comparison
// BUG: Boolean context
if ($string) { } // '0' is falsy, but non-empty
2. Loose Comparison Issues
php
// BUG: == instead of ===
if ($status == 0) { } // 'active' == 0 is true!
// BUG: in_array without strict
if (in_array($value, $array)) { } // Type coercion
// FIXED: in_array($value, $array, true)
// BUG: array_search
$key = array_search($value, $array); // Returns false or key
if ($key) { } // Key 0 is falsy!

7. Numeric String Issues
php
// BUG: Numeric string comparison
$a = '10';
$b = '9';
if ($a > $b) { } // String comparison: '1' < '9', so false!
// FIXED:
if ((int) $a > (int) $b) { }

Best Practices
Use Strict Types
php
declare(strict_types=1);
Use Strict Comparison
php
if ($status === 0) { }
if (in_array($value, $array, true)) { }
Type Hints Everywhere
php
function process(array $items): int
{
return count($items);
}
Use instanceof
php
if ($object instanceof User) {
$object->getName();
}
